Output 331625d33fe34b6be8b3d4b1a8c836c541874f2c59ced8e05af2dfa804f4c773:10

value
10653786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dea49d81b1fb77159b48edd93f76a62e7d679ca OP_EQUAL
address
3QqbYiwo2S2CjNw1F5noMHU4U8ge4GDuRh
transaction
331625d33fe34b6be8b3d4b1a8c836c541874f2c59ced8e05af2dfa804f4c773